About This Color

PANTONE Green Tint is a desaturated green with bright tonality. Its HEX value is #C5CCC0, placing it in the green region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 95°.

This lighter shade is well-suited for backgrounds, accent areas, and designs that require an open, airy feel. It pairs naturally with darker neutrals for contrast.
